We’re Hiring: MIG Welders – Deeside

As we continue our journey of growth and expansion to serve this new era of nuclear, Boccard UK is looking for talented Welders to join our team at our fully digitalised manufacturing site in Deeside, near Chester.

If you're passionate about quality, safety, and working in a clean, modern environment, this could be your next move.

What You’ll Be Doing
Perform MIG welds on carbon steel supports for Hinkley Point Nuclear Power Station
Work at each stage of manufacturing and construction
Collaborate with a diverse team of welders, fabricators, and operators
Ensure all work meets strict quality standards, including visual and NDT inspections
Follow safe working practices in a clean, digitalised facility

What You’ll Bring
Recognised welding qualifications (e.g. ECITB, CITB, NASEC, or Level 3 Diplomas)
Coded MIG welding experience in a highly regulated industry
Computer literacy and strong communication skills
A quality-first mindset and high personal standards
Organised and able to prioritise in a fast-paced environment

What We’re Looking For
Welders eligible to work in the UK
Willingness to complete BPSS screening and hold a Safety Passport (e.g. CSCS/CCSNG)
All new welders will complete codings during their 6-month probation.

Disability Confident
A Disability Confident employer will generally offer an interview to any applicant that declares they have a disability and meets the minimum criteria for the job as defined by the employer. It is important to note that in certain recruitment situations such as high-volume, seasonal and high-peak times, the employer may wish to limit the overall numbers of interviews offered to both disabled people and non-disabled people.
